Barossa Valley Cabernet is also a force to be reckoned with, and Gold-winning The Pastor’s Son Cabernet boasts generous lashings of rich dark blackcurrant, forest fruits, elegant herbs and spice, and comes from another of the region’s best, 5 Red Star-rated producers… Peter Lehmann was indeed a Pastor’s Son, a fifth-generation Barossa winemaker, a member of the Order of Australia, called “a legend in his own lifetime” (Halliday) and “the most famous man in the Australian wine business” (Matthew Jukes). Back in the 1970’s, he championed small independent grape growers, through days when the big wineries reneged on their contracts. He never lost their loyalty, and it earned him the title ‘Baron of the Barossa’.
